Bright gastropub with seasonal menus, stripped wood flooring & chic rooms in a Georgian building. Set in a Georgian building overlooking the Witney village green, this quaint village pub with chic rooms sits 0.8 miles from the A40. The 10 contemporary rooms offer free Wi-Fi, flat-screen TVs with satellite channels, hospitality trays and en suite bathrooms. Family rooms are available. The gastropub with stripped wood floors serves a seasonal all-day menu, as well as a traditional evening menu and an extensive wine list. Breakfast is also available.

Hotel located on the village/town green and we arrived with the hotel bathed in evening sunshine. Great atmosphere at the hotel. Very friendly and efficient staff. Evening meal was good quality and good menu choice. Breakfasts were similar standard and good amounts. Room was spacious overlooking the Green and bed and pillows were very comfortable. A good night's sleep. Hotel in a good location for striking out to Oxford to the east and The Cotswolds in the west. I'd recommend to anyone who is looking for an unpretentious hotel in that area.

The Fleece likes think of itself as Witney's premier eating establishment, and indeed it does have a lot to offer... The food is thoughtful, tasty and well delivered. Is it anything extraordinary though? Well no, not really. The attitude in the Fleece borders on pretentious, but you kind of get the feeling this is the reason locals love it so much - It is a little bit of snobbery and exclusiveness in a town where such attributes are few and far between. As a result, it tends to be fairly hard to get a table in the evening, especially if you are just a walk in. Seating also feels a little overcrowded and not particularly well organised. The Fleece is best visited on a sunny afternoon for a glass of wine or two, or on a colder day- a nice cup of coffee, and a selection of nibbles from the deli board.
